技术开发过程记录与审核工具集.docVIP

  1. 1、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

技术开发过程记录与审核工具集

一、适用场景与核心价值

本工具集聚焦技术开发全过程的规范化管理,适用于以下核心场景:

复杂项目多角色协作:当需求方、开发、测试、运维等多团队需同步信息时,通过结构化记录避免信息差,保证目标一致;

需求频繁变更:对需求变更的影响范围、实施路径、风险控制进行全程留痕,避免“口头变更”“随意调整”;

合规与审计要求:满足金融、医疗等对开发过程可追溯性要求较高的行业,提供完整证据链;

知识沉淀与复盘:通过记录关键决策、问题处理经验,为后续项目提供参考,减少重复试错。

二、全流程操作步骤详解

(一)需求阶段:变更可控,依据可查

目标:保证需求明确、变更受控,避免后期“需求扯皮”。

操作步骤:

初始需求登记:由产品经理填写《需求登记表》,明确需求背景、目标、功能描述、验收标准、优先级、预计交付时间,同步提交给技术负责人*和技术委员会审核;

需求变更触发:如需变更,由需求方提交《需求变更申请》,说明变更原因、具体内容(原需求vs变更后)、影响范围(如开发量、测试周期、成本);

变更评估与审批:开发负责人组织技术团队评估变更工作量,测试负责人评估对测试的影响,三方签字确认后,提交给项目总监*审批;

变更结果同步:审批通过后,产品经理更新需求文档,并在需求管理系统中标记变更状态,同步所有相关方。

(二)设计阶段:方案可溯,风险前置

目标:保证技术方案合理、设计文档完整,提前规避架构或实现层面的风险。

操作步骤:

方案设计输出:架构师*根据需求文档完成《技术方案设计》,包含架构图、模块划分、技术选型、接口定义、功能指标、容灾方案等;

方案评审会议:组织开发、测试、运维团队召开评审会,重点评估方案可行性、扩展性、安全性,记录评审意见(如“模块间耦合度需降低”“接口参数需补充校验逻辑”);

方案修订与确认:架构师*根据评审意见修订方案,形成《技术方案终稿》,由所有参会人员签字确认,作为开发阶段的基准文档;

设计文档归档:将终稿提交至文档管理系统,关联对应需求编号,方便后续查阅。

(三)开发阶段:进度可视,质量可控

目标:实时跟踪开发进度,规范代码审核,保证代码质量符合标准。

操作步骤:

开发任务拆解:开发负责人将需求拆分为可执行的任务(如“用户登录模块开发”“数据库表设计”),分配至具体开发人员,明确任务起止时间和交付物;

进度每日更新:开发人员*通过项目管理系统(如Jira)更新任务进度,填写《开发进度跟踪表》,记录当日完成内容、遇到的问题、需协调资源;

代码审核执行:

开发人员*完成代码自测后,提交代码审核请求,关联对应任务编号;

审核人(资深开发*)依据《代码审核检查表》(含编码规范、逻辑正确性、功能优化点、安全性等)进行审核,填写审核意见(如“变量命名不符合规范”“SQL查询未加索引”);

开发人员*根据意见修改代码,重新提交审核,直至通过;

版本管理规范:所有代码需提交至Git仓库,遵循“分支管理规范”(如主干分支master、开发分支dev、功能分支feature/*),提交信息需明确(如“feat:添加用户登录接口”)。

(四)测试阶段:问题闭环,质量达标

目标:全面发觉并跟踪问题,保证上线前缺陷修复完成。

操作步骤

测试用例设计:测试负责人*根据需求文档和设计文档编写《测试用例》,覆盖功能、功能、兼容性、安全性等场景,用例需明确前置条件、操作步骤、预期结果;

测试执行与问题记录:测试人员*执行测试用例,发觉问题后通过缺陷管理系统(如禅道)提交《测试问题报告》,包含问题标题、复现步骤、实际结果、严重级别(致命/严重/一般/轻微)、所属模块、附件(如截图、日志);

问题跟踪与修复:开发人员认领问题,分析原因并修复,更新问题状态(“处理中”→“待验证”→“已关闭”);测试人员验证修复结果,若未通过则重新提交;

测试报告输出:测试负责人*汇总测试数据(用例通过率、缺陷遗留数、风险点),编制《测试报告》,明确是否达到上线标准。

(五)上线阶段:检查清单,发布可控

目标:保证上线过程安全、风险可控,出现问题能快速回滚。

操作步骤:

上线前检查:运维负责人*对照《上线前检查表》(含环境配置、数据备份、监控告警、回滚方案、应急预案等)逐项检查,签字确认;

发布方案审批:项目经理编制《上线发布方案》,明确发布时间窗口、发布步骤、责任人、回滚触发条件,提交至运维总监审批;

上线执行与监控:运维人员按方案执行发布,开发人员现场支持,监控系统(CPU、内存、接口响应时间等)实时运行状态,记录异常情况;

上线后确认:产品经理和测试人员验证核心功能,确认无误后,发布上线通知,并在系统中更新版本号。

(六)归档阶段:资料完整,经验沉淀

目标:保证项目资料完整,为后续项目提供参考。

操作步骤:

资料汇总:项目经理*收集各阶段文档(需求

文档评论(0)

189****7452 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档